"Biden's Visit to Fire-Ravaged Maui Sparks Controversy and Criticism"

TL;DR Summary
President Joe Biden is set to visit fire-ravaged Maui on Monday to witness the devastation caused by the deadliest American wildfire in over 100 years. His initial response to the Maui wildfires drew criticism, but he has since signed an emergency declaration and remained in regular contact with state officials. During his visit, Biden plans to speak with state officials, emergency responders, and survivors, and will assign a senior FEMA official to coordinate long-term federal response efforts. The president aims to reassure residents that the federal government will support their recovery and help them rebuild according to their vision.
